The role of Chef Manager at Aramark is a critical leadership position centered around delivering exceptional food and customer service experiences. Reporting directly to the General Manager, the Chef Manager takes a hands-on approach to managing culinary operations with a strong focus on team development, culinary expertise, adherence to safety protocols, and maintaining excellent client relations. This position demands a balance of creativity, organizational skills, and business acumen to meet budget requirements and execute company directives effectively. The Chef Manager is not just responsible for food preparation but also for ensuring that the team is motivated, trained, and supported to uphold the highest standards of quality and consistency. This role also involves managing kitchen staff, estimating food requirements, selecting and standardizing recipes, establishing presentation and quality standards, and monitoring kitchen equipment and safety standards. Additionally, the Chef Manager may oversee special catering events and provide culinary instruction, demonstrating advanced culinary techniques to the team.

Job Duties
- train and manage kitchen personnel and supervise or coordinate all related culinary activities
- estimate food consumption and requisition or purchase food
- select and develop recipes as well as standardize production recipes to ensure consistent quality
- establish presentation technique and quality standards, and plan and price menus
- ensure proper equipment operation or maintenance and ensure proper safety and sanitation in kitchen
- oversee special catering events and may also offer culinary instruction and or demonstrates culinary techniques
